One of the biggest and most talked about code is 2003

This is the code everyone is talking about when it comes to coyote contests. Please and I say Please, don't just think of this code as they are stopping coyote contests. If the changes they want happen it will have a wide change to everything. It will stop every type of contest available. Have you ever gone on a fishing (Cattle) boat and put $5.00 in a bucket for the biggest fish of the day. Well that will be a thing of the past. This will change every type of contest in the marine or mammal arena. (Pope and Young, Boone and Crocket and big game contest could all be affected possible)
